ContraFect Corp. is a biotechnology company focused on developing innovative therapies for serious bacterial infections, particularly those caused by antibiotic-resistant pathogens. Its lead product candidate, CF-301, is designed to treat Staphylococcus aureus infections, which presents a significant market opportunity given the rising prevalence of antibiotic resistance.
ContraFect is primarily in the research and development phase, focusing on the development of CF-301 and other therapeutic candidates. Revenue generation is expected to commence upon successful clinical trials and subsequent commercialization. The company has a unique position in targeting antibiotic-resistant infections, which are a growing public health concern.
